Panama-flagged bulk carrier Filia Grace has been reported to be adrift in the Indian Ocean following an engine failure.

The ship’s crew is trying to repair the engine that broke down on June 15th.

The drifting bulker, owned and managed by the Greek company Pitiousa Shipping, was spotted adrift by nearby vessels some 160 nautial miles south of Port Maturin, Mauritius, Maritime Bulletin Daily reports.

As informed, there were no significant damages to the 26,412 DWT vessel and all crew are reported to be safe.

The ship, built in 1997, is believed to be carrying 14,000 tons of rice to Bata, Equatorial Guinea.
